Marcia Kay Lyons-Noonan, 73, of Elkhart, passed away peacefully at Valley View Healthcare Center in Elkhart on Wednesday, November 18, 2020 at 4:19 am following an extended illness. She was born in Elkhart to the late Cloise and Geraldine (Stryker) Lambert, and is preceded in death by her spouses, Pat Fiorentino, Richard Lyons and Paul Noonan and is currently survived by her fiancé, John Falvey of Elkhart.
Also surviving are her daughters and their spouses Brandi & Gregory Varey of Chandler, AZ, Allicia & Bryant Andrus of Mesa, AZ and sons Chad Fiorentino of Warsaw, IN, Brandon Lyons of Winslow, AZ, and Barry Lyons of Tempe, AZ and grandchildren Genevieve and Annalee Andrus, Tamara and Amy Lyons, Serenity Jones, Shannon McCabe, Hunter Fiorentino and Dylan and Sarah Holt, as well as a host of loving extended family and friends.
Additionally, children Toni Holt and Chance Fiorentino, as well as brother Steven Lambert, have all preceded Marcia in death.
In accordance with her wishes, there will be a brief viewing and visitation at Billings Funeral Home of Elkhart on Saturday, November 28, 2020 from 10am to 11am. From there, Marcia will be taken to Olive West Cemetery in Elkhart where a graveside service will be held at 11:30 am. Please note that due to the COVID 19 restrictions unique to Elkhart County, masking and social distancing must be maintained and capacity restrictions may be in effect if deemed necessary.
Marcia spent most of her life as a homemaker, making sure she did her best for her family and children. She loved crafts and scrapbooking and never met a dog she didn't like!
